区块链四个基础技术
-
区块链主要技术包括
区块链是一种基于分布式账本技术的数字化记录系统,它的主要技术包括以下几个方面: 分布式网络:区块链技术利用分布式网络来存储交易和数据记录,所有参与者都可以共享这些账本信息。这样的设计使得区块链系统具有去中心化的特点,增强了系统的安全性和透明度。 密码学: 区块链使用密码学技术来确保交易和数据的安全性。其中,哈希函数用于记录数据的完整性,数字签名用于确认交易的合法性,共识算法用于保证网络的一致性。 智能合约: 智能合约是一种在区块链上执行的程序代码,它可以自动地执行、控制或记录合约条款。智能合约的出...
-
区块链的四项核心技术
区块链技术通常被分为四种主要模型,它们是:1. 公有链(Public Blockchain): 公有链是最为人熟知的区块链模型之一,也是最具去中心化特性的。在公有链上,任何人都可以参与网络,并且可以查看、验证和添加新的交易记录。比特币和以太坊就是两个知名的公有链项目。公有链的主要优点是去中心化和透明度,但也存在一些挑战,比如性能限制和隐私问题。2. 私有链(Private Blockchain): 与公有链相对,私有链是由单个实体或组织控制和管理的区块链网络。只有经过授权的参与者可以访问和执行交易。这种...